The latest value from 2022 is 28.7 percent, an increase from 27.63 percent in 2021. In comparison, the world average is 71.68 percent, based on data from 177 countries. Historically, the average for Sudan from 1990 to 2022 is 7.41 percent. The minimum value, 0 percent, was reached in 1990 while the maximum of 28.7 percent was recorded in 2022. The internet users in Sudan and other countries are presented as the percent of people who have access to the internet either at home, at work, or in public spaces.
Definition: Internet users are individuals who have used the Internet (from any location) in the last 3 months. The Internet can be used via a computer, mobile phone, personal digital assistant, games machine, digital TV etc.
